Nahal Alexander (Alexander Stream)

Nahal Alexander (Alexander Stream), flowing from the mountains of Samaria to the Mediterranean Sea, is a declared National Park, a charming natural area featuring also agricultural fields. The site features several focal points- one is Kedem Park, which has beautiful recreational areas with charming corners shaded by orchard trees and ornamental trees. The Park spreads over both sides of the stream and its banks are connected with Irish bridges. Turtle Park and Turtle Bridge- in the water of this stream lives a big population of soft-shell water turtles, rare animals in Israel. The Turtle Bridge crosses over Alexander Stream to the east of Kfar Vitkin and near it many of the turtles gather. This place also offers sitting areas and children’s playgrounds, an observation platform overlooking the stream and an observation tower. Italy Park, a section of the stream which is a part of the Alexander Stream rehabilitation project, offers extensive lawns, rich vegetation, parks, sitting areas and a café. The dirt paths in the park are accessible to wheelchairs and strollers.
